ABRASIVES
SPEEDLOCK ALLOY ANGULAR STEEL GRIT AND LOW CARBON MIXED SHOTS
ALLOY ANGULAR STEEL GRIT is mainly used in compressed air pressure blasting operation and have the following advantages over High
Carbon Steel Grit due to its fully angular shape, more homogeneous hardness, higher density and better wear resistance (Nice Microstructure).
The Hardness and Wear Resistance properties are due to its High Chromium and Carbon contents plus the unique manufacturing process and the
raw-material used.
LOW CARBON STEEL SHOT is specially formulated for use in Auto-Blast Wheel Machine operation to improve blasting performance and has
better wear-resistance than High Carbon Steel Shot. Due to lesser break-down of the Low Carbon Steel Shot, there will be less wear and tear on
expensive Auto-Blast Machine components due to abrasion by fine steel dusts. The Hardness and Wear Resistance properties are due to its high
Manganese content plus the unique manufacturing process and the raw-material used.

GP Angular when new, this grit rapidly round off in use and is suited for de-scaling applications.
GL Although harder than GP Steel Grit, it also loses its sharp edges during blasting operations and is particularly suited for de-scaling
and surface preparation applications
GH Has the maximum hardness and remains in angular shape even after each blasting operation. It is suitable for surface treatment
process that required uniform etched finishes. GH Steel Grit should be only use in auto-shot blast machine where working
requirements take precedence over cost consideration (e.g. with roll mill cylinders or where a special surface finish is needed).
